Abstract
BACKGROUND Living donor liver transplant (LDLT) is based on the principle of double equipoise. Organ shortage in Asian countries has led to development of high-volume LDLT programs with good outcomes. Safety of live liver donor is the Achilles heel of LDLT program and every effort should be made to achieve low morbidity and near zero mortality rates. METHODS We retrospectively analyzed our prospectively maintained donor morbidity data (outcomes) of 177 donors in a new transplant program setup in western India by an experienced surgeon. The primary end point was to analyze the morbidity rates and the factors associated with it. RESULTS None of the donors in our cohort of 177 donors developed grade IV or V complication (Clavien-Dindo classification). One-fourth (1/4th) of the donors developed complications ranging from grade I to grade III(b). The rate of complications according to modified Clavien-Dindo classification is as follows: (1) grade I in 5.6% (n = 10), (2) grade II in 14.6% (n = 26), (3) grade III(a) in 3.9% (n = 7), (4) grade III(b) in 2.2% (n = 4). Three donors (1.6%) developed post-hepatectomy intra-abdominal bleeding and required re-exploration (grade IIIb). All of them recovered well post-surgery and are doing well in follow-up. The mean follow-up of the entire cohort was 2871 ± 521 days (range 1926-3736 days). CONCLUSION Donor safety (outcome) is determined by meticulous donor surgery and good-quality remnant.

Abstract
OBJECTIVE Evaluate outcome of left-lobe graft (LLG) first combined with purely laparoscopic donor hemihepatectomy (PLDH) as a strategy to minimize donor risk. BACKGROUND An LLG first approach and a PLDH are 2 methods used to reduce surgical stress for donors in adult living donor liver transplantation (LDLT). But the risk associated with application LLG first combined with PLDH is not known. METHODS From 2012 to 2023, 186 adult LDLTs were performed with hemiliver grafts, procured by open surgery in 95 and PLDH in 91 cases. LLGs were considered first when graft-to-recipient weight ratio ≥0.6%. Following a 4-month adoption process, all donor hepatectomies, since December 2019, were performed laparoscopically. RESULTS There was one intraoperative conversion to open (1%). Mean operative times were similar in laparoscopic and open cases (366 vs 371 minutes). PLDH provided shorter hospital stays, lower blood loss, and lower peak aspartate aminotransferase. Peak bilirubin was lower in LLG donors compared with right-lobe graft donors (1.4 vs 2.4 mg/dL, P < 0.01), and PLDH further improved the bilirubin levels in LLG donors (1.2 vs 1.6 mg/dL, P < 0.01). PLDH also afforded a low rate of early complications (Clavien-Dindo grade ≥ II, 8% vs 22%, P = 0.007) and late complications, including incisional hernia (0% vs 13.7%, P < 0.001), compared with open cases. LLG was more likely to have a single duct than a right-lobe graft (89% vs 60%, P < 0.01). Importantly, with the aggressive use of LLG in 47% of adult LDLT, favorable graft survival was achieved without any differences between the type of graft and surgical approach. CONCLUSIONS The LLG first with PLDH approach minimizes surgical stress for donors in adult LDLT without compromising recipient outcomes. This strategy can lighten the burden for living donors, which could help expand the donor pool.

Abstract
OBJECTIVE Living donor liver transplantation (LDLT) using small grafts, especially left lobe grafts (H1234-MHV) (LLG), continues to be a challenge due to small-for-size syndrome (SFSS). We herein demonstrate that with surgical modifications, outcomes with small grafts can be improved. METHODS Between 2012 and 2020, we performed 130 adult LDLT using 61 (47%) LLG (H1234-MHV) in a single Enterprise. The median graft-to-recipient weight ratio was 0.84%, with graft-to-recipient weight ratio <0.7% accounting for 22%. Splenectomy was performed in 72 (56%) patients for inflow modulation before (n=50) or after (n=22) graft reperfusion. In LLG-LDLT, venous outflow was achieved using all three recipient hepatic veins. In right lobe graft (H5678) (RLG)-LDLT, the augmented graft right hepatic vein was anastomosed to the recipient's cava with a large cavotomy. Outcome measures include SFSS, early allograft dysfunction (EAD), and survival. RESULTS Graft survival rates at 1, 3, and 5 years were 94%, 90%, and 83%, respectively, with no differences between LLG (H1234-MHV) and RLG (H5678). Splenectomy significantly reduced portal flow without increasing the complication rate. Despite the aggressive use of small grafts, SFSS and EAD developed in only 1 (0.8%) and 18 (13.8%) patients, respectively. Multivariable logistic regression revealed model for end-stage liver disease score and LLG (H1234-MHV) as independent risk factors for EAD and splenectomy as a protective factor (odds ratio: 0.09; P =0.03). For LLG (H1234-MHV)-LDLT, patients who underwent prereperfusion splenectomy tended to have better 1-year graft survival than those receiving postreperfusion splenectomy. CONCLUSIONS LLG (H1234-MHV) are feasible in adult LDLT with excellent outcomes comparable to RLG (H5678). Venous outflow augmentation and splenectomy help lower the threshold of using small-for-size grafts without compromising graft survival.

Abstract
Objective: The health-related quality of life (HRQoL) of donors deserves attention and must be considered for a long time. Many of the published studies had small sample sizes, and research from mainland China, in particular, is scant. Thus, this study aimed to investigate the HRQoL of living liver donors and identify the influencing factors of the HRQoL in mainland China. Methods: This is a cross-sectional study. The data were collected from the liver transplantation center, the Tianjin First Center Hospital, China. Living liver donors older than 18 years and at a minimum of 1-month, post-donation was included. The HRQoL was evaluated using the Medical Outcome Study Short form 36 (SF-36). Sociodemographic and clinical-related variables, HRQoL status, and its potential impact factors were analyzed. Results: A total of 382 living liver donors completed the survey. The median number of months post-donation was 25, and parental donors (99.2%) were the most frequent relationship. The majority of the participants (372, 97.4%) donated their left lateral lobes. Thirty-two (8.4%) donors suffered complications, and of them, 7 suffered from biliary leakage (1.8%), which was the most common one in this study. The physical functioning (PF), role–physical (RP), bodily pain (BP), general health (GH), social functioning (SF), role–emotional (RE), and mental health (MH) scores among the living liver donors were significantly better than those of the Chinese norms. Short-time post-donation [odds ratio (OR): 0.008; p < 0.001] and male recipients (OR:0.195; p = 0.024) were associated with the likelihood of a poor physical related quality of life. Conclusions: Despite, in general, good HRQoL outcomes, we also believed that liver donation has an obvious influence on the physical functions of liver donors. More attention and long-term follow-ups are necessary for donors at higher risk based on identified influencing factors and correlates.

Abstract
BACKGROUND Conventional wisdom dictates that a larger hepatectomy is more prone to complications. Consequently, with the donor safety as paramount, the transplant community has intuitively been proponents of left lobe donation in live donor liver transplantation (LDLT), thereby satisfying the tenet of double equipoise. More recently some data suggest that this may not always be the case, especially in established centres. Our aim was to compare right and left lobe donor outcomes in LDLT from a centre with cumulative experience. METHODS Review of a prospectively collected database of right and left lobe liver donors operated between August 2009 and July 2017 was performed. Their preoperative demographics, operative and post-operative outcomes were compared. RESULTS Of 904 liver transplantations, 458 were right lobe donors [379 without middle hepatic vein (MHV), 79 with MHV] and 58 left lobe donors. There was a significant difference in GRWR and functional liver remnant between the right and left lobe donors (1.27 ± 0.45 vs. 1.03 ± 0.28 p = 0.004, and 63.2 ± 7.9 vs. 37.7 ± 16.3, respectively, p value). The end portal pressure (7 vs. 8 mmHg p = <0.001), peak bilirubin (1.6 ± 0.8 vs. 2.9 ± 1.5 p = <0.001) and day 5 bilirubin (0.8 ± 0.3 vs. 1.4 ± 0.9 p = <0.001) were significantly higher in right lobe donors. There was no difference in blood loss, duration of surgery or peak lactate between the groups. Complications (20.7% vs. 25.9% p = 0.48), including serious complications (Clavien-Dindo > III) (6.9% vs. 8.1% p = 0.95), duration of ICU and hospital stay, were comparable between the groups. Subgroup analysis between left lobe and right lobe with and without MHV donor was also comparable. CONCLUSION Though biochemical differences exist between the groups, no difference in outcomes was noted. Despite larger liver mass loss in right lobe donors, a strict protocol-based approach to donor selection leads to comparable outcomes between left lobe and right lobe donations.

Abstract
BACKGROUND To assess the impact of living liver donation (LD) in a diverse and aging population up to 20 y after donation, particularly with regard to medical, financial, psychosocial, and overall health-related quality of life (HRQOL). METHODS Patients undergoing LD between 1999 and 2009 were recruited to respond to the Short-Form 36 and a novel Donor Quality of Life Survey at two time points (2010 and 2018). RESULTS Sixty-eight living liver donors (LLDs) completed validated surveys, with a mean follow-up of 11.5 ± 5.1 y. Per Donor Quality of Life Survey data, physical activity or strength was not impacted by LD in most patients. All respondents returned to school or employment, and 82.4% reported that LD had no impact on school or work performance. LD did not impact health insurability in 95.6% of donors, and only one patient experienced difficulty obtaining life insurance. Overall, 97.1% of respondents did not regret LD. Short-Form 36 survey-measured outcomes were similar between LLDs and the general U.S. POPULATION LLDs who responded in both 2010 and 2018 were followed for an overall average of 15.4 ± 2.4 y and HRQOL outcomes in these donors also remained statistically equivalent to U.S. population norms. CONCLUSIONS This study represents the longest postdonation follow-up and offers unique insight related to HRQOL in a highly diverse patient population. Although LLDs continue to maintain excellent HRQOL outcomes up to 20 y after donation, continued lifetime follow-up is required to accurately provide young, healthy potential donors with an accurate description of the risks that they may incur on aging.

Abstract
BACKGROUND The use of a minimally invasive laparoscopic approach in living donor hepatectomy is increasing with the need for enhanced management of living donors. Hypotensive bradycardia often occurs during abdominal surgery and can be fatal without proper management. We conducted a retrospective study to investigate the incidence and risk factors of symptomatic (hypotensive) bradycardia in laparoscopic living donor hepatectomy. METHODS Hypotensive bradycardia is defined as the heart rate below 60 beats per minute with simultaneous mean arterial blood pressure (MAP) below 65 mm Hg. Clinical characteristics of liver donors were collected and analyzed from May 2018 to July 2019. RESULTS This study included 129 cases of living donor hepatectomy; 11 donors of open hepatectomy were excluded, and 118 donors undergoing laparoscopic hepatectomy were analyzed. Hypotensive bradycardia was shown in 27 donors. Hypertension or angiotensin receptor blocker medication were significantly related to hypotensive bradycardia. Hypotensive bradycardia occurred after incision in 22 donors, and the onset time from the incision was 7.5 minutes [first quartile (Q1) 5.75, third quartile (Q3) 11.5, range 0-25], the minimum heart rate was 48.5 beats per minute (Q1 41.5, Q3 53.25, range 25-57), and the minimum MAP was 55 mm Hg (Q1 45, Q3 57.5, range 35-63). It took 132 seconds (Q1 42, Q3 189, range 12-408) to recover MAP over 65 mm Hg. CONCLUSIONS Hypotensive bradycardia occurred in 22.9% of the laparoscopic living donor hepatectomy cases, and 80.6% of cases occurred after incision. Thorough preoperative evaluation and close monitoring is important even in a healthy donor.

Abstract
OBJECTIVES The safety of living liver donors is considered a high priority. In this study, we aimed to highlight the incidence and risk factors of respiratory complications among living liver transplant donors at our institute. MATERIALS AND METHODS We evaluated data of 178 related living liver donors who were seen from January 2014 to December 2018. We recorded significant respiratory complications, such as pulmonary embolism, pleural effusion, pneumothorax, pneumonia, acute lung injury, acute respiratory distress syndrome, and transfusion-related acute lung injury. Complications were noted as clinically evident and/or needing intervention. We also recorded the frequency of nonrespiratory complications and duration of intensive care unit and hospital stays. RESULTS Ten donors (5.6%) developed significant respiratory complications: 2 (1.1%) had pulmonary embolisms, 3 (1.7%) developed symptomatic pleural effusion that required thoracentesis, and 4 (2.25%) had chest infections. The remaining donor (0.6%) had unexplained respiratory insufficiency. Logistic regression analyses identified age ≥ 35 years and previous surgery as the main risk factors of significant respiratory complications. There were no recorded cases of pneumothorax, acute lung injury, acute respiratory distress syndrome, and transfusion-related acute lung injury. Raw surface collection (14.6%) and biliary leakage (7.9%) were the most frequent nonrespiratory complications. There was no significant difference between patients with and without significant respiratory complications with regard to intensive care unit and hospital stays. CONCLUSIONS Despite the low incidence of significant respiratory complications among our living liver donor cohort, close monitoring and early management are essential to achieve better prognosis, especially in donors older than 35 years or those with previous surgery.

Abstract
Background Although left-lobe donation is considered safer, right-sided donor hepatectomy predominates in adult living donor liver transplantation (LDLT). We hypothesized that bilateral proficiency with donor hepatectomy reduces overall donor complications. Methods A retrospective review of 834 adult LDLT donors (221 left lobes) from January 2004 to December 2014 was performed, dividing cases into two eras based on left-graft experience. Donor complications within 6 months were investigated, focusing on graft side and surgical era. Results The overall complication rate was 17.6%, and was higher in right-lobe donors. In Era 2, during which left-lobe donation rates were three times higher, total complications decreased (14.7% vs. 20.9%, P=0.02). A significant reduction in postoperative ascites accounted for the lower overall complication rate. The proportion of major biliary complications (BCs) was halved from 62.5% to 25.0%. Right-lobe donor complications also decreased significantly (15.8% vs. 22.9%, P=0.032), demonstrating that it was not only increased left-lobe donations leading to lowered complication rates, but also greater experience with donor hepatectomy in general. Conclusions Accumulating experience with bilateral donor hepatectomy leads to decreased donor morbidity and comparable outcomes for right and left lobes, further enhancing the goal of donor safety while balancing recipient needs.

Abstract
BACKGROUND & AIMS Death rates on liver transplant waiting lists range from 5%-25%. Herein, we report a unique experience with 50 anonymous individuals who volunteered to address this gap by offering to donate part of their liver to a recipient with whom they had no biological connection or prior relationship, so called anonymous live liver donation (A-LLD). METHODS Candidates were screened to confirm excellent physical, mental, social, and financial health. Demographics and surgical outcomes were analyzed. Qualitative interviews after donation examined motivation and experiences. Validated self-reported questionnaires assessed personality traits and psychological impact. RESULTS A total of 50 A-LLD liver transplants were performed between 2005 and 2017. Most donors had a university education, a middle-class income, and a history of prior altruism. Half were women. Median age was 38.5 years (range 20-59). Thirty-three (70%) learned about this opportunity through public or social media. Saving a life, helping others, generativity, and reciprocity for past generosity were motivators. Social, financial, healthcare, and legal support in Canada were identified as facilitators. A-LLD identified most with the personality traits of agreeableness and conscientiousness. The median hospital stay was 6 days. One donor experienced a Dindo-Clavien Grade 3 complication that completely resolved. One-year recipient survival was 91% in 22 adults and 97% in 28 children. No A-LLD reported regretting their decision. CONCLUSIONS This is the first and only report of the characteristics, motivations and facilitators of A-LLD in a large cohort. With rigorous protocols, outcomes are excellent. A-LLD has significant potential to reduce the gap between transplant organ demand and availability. LAY SUMMARY We report a unique experience with 50 living donors who volunteered to donate to a recipient with whom they had no biological connection or prior relationship (anonymous living donors). This report is the first to discuss motivations, strategies and facilitators that may mitigate physical, social and ethical risk factors in this patient population. With rigorous protocols, anonymous liver donation and recipient outcomes are excellent; with appropriate clinical expertise and system facilitators in place, our experience suggests that other centers may consider the procedure for its significant potential to reduce the gap between transplant organ demand and availability.

Abstract
Background Wisteria floribunda agglutinin positive human Mac-2 binding protein glycosylation isomer (M2BPGi) has recently developed as a noninvasive serum marker of liver fibrosis. Liver transplant candidates usually have high serum levels of M2BPGi due to advanced cirrhosis. The aim of the present study was to elucidate the kinetics of serum M2BPGi after liver transplantation and the relationships between the level of M2BPGi and graft function. Methods Fifteen recipients who underwent living donor liver transplantation (LDLT) between June 2015 and January 2016 and whose pretransplant, postoperative day (POD) 1, POD 3, and POD 7 sera were available for measuring M2BPGi were enrolled in this study. Small-for-size syndrome (SFSS) was defined as the presence of cholestasis (total bilirubin >10 mg/dL) on POD 7 and intractable ascites (>1 L/day on POD 14 or >500 ml/day on POD 28) without other specific causes. Results The median of pretransplant M2BPGi was 9.75 cutoff index (C.O.I.) (range, 3.04-24.49). There was neither any correlation between pretransplant M2BPGi and Model for End-Stage Liver Disease scores (r=0.416, P=0.123) nor Child-Turcotte-Pugh scores (r=-0.221, P=0.428). The levels of M2BPGi dramatically decreased after LDLT (median; 1.48 on POD 1, 1.47 on POD 3, 1.49 on POD 7). However, serum levels of M2BPGi rose again on POD 7 in some recipients and all 4 recipients with serum levels of M2BPGi exceeding 3.00 C.O.I. succumbed to SFSS later. When the cutoff of M2BPGi on POD 7 for predicting SFSS was determined to be 3.06 according to its receiver operating characteristic curve, both the sensitivity and the specificity for predicting later SFSS were 100%. Conclusions The levels of M2BPGi dramatically decreased after LDLT. A re-rise of M2BPGi predicted later development of SFSS.

Abstract
BACKGROUND Liver transplantation is the treatment for end-stage liver diseases and well-selected malignancies. The allograft shortage may be alleviated with living donation. The initial UCLouvain experience of adult living-donor liver transplantation (LDLT) is presented. METHODS A retrospective analysis of 64 adult-to-adult LDLTs performed at our institution between 1998 and 2016 was conducted. The median age of 29 (45.3%) females and 35 (54.7%) males was 50.2 years (interquartile range, IQR 32.9-57.5). Twenty-two (34.4%) recipients had no portal hypertension. Three (4.7%) patients had a benign and 33 (51.6%) a malignant tumor [19 (29.7%) hepatocellular cancer, 11 (17.2%) secondary cancer and one (1.6%) each hemangioendothelioma, hepatoblastoma and embryonal liver sarcoma]. Median donor and recipient follow-ups were 93 months (IQR 41-159) and 39 months (22-91), respectively. RESULTS Right and left hemi-livers were implanted in 39 (60.9%) and 25 (39.1%) cases, respectively. Median weights of right- and left-liver were 810 g (IQR 730-940) and 454 g (IQR 394-534), respectively. Graft-to-recipient weight ratios (GRWRs) were 1.17% (right, IQR 0.98%-1.4%) and 0.77% (left, 0.59%-0.95%). One- and five-year patient survivals were 85% and 71% (right) vs. 84% and 58% (left), respectively. One- and five-year graft survivals were 74% and 61% (right) vs. 76% and 53% (left), respectively. The patient and graft survival of right and left grafts and of very small (<0.6%), small (0.6%-0.79%) and large (≥0.8%) GRWR were similar. Survival of very small grafts was 86% and 86% at 3- and 12-month. No donor died while five (7.8%) developed a Clavien-Dindo complication IIIa, IIIb or IV. Recipient morbidity consisted mainly of biliary and vascular complications; three (4.7%) recipients developed a small-for-size syndrome according to the Kyushu criteria. CONCLUSIONS Adult-to-adult LDLT is a demanding procedure that widens therapeutic possibilities of many hepatobiliary diseases. The donor procedure can be done safely with low morbidity. The recipient operation carries a major morbidity indicating an important learning curve. Shifting the risk from the donor to the recipient, by moving from the larger right-liver to the smaller left-liver grafts, should be further explored as this policy makes donor hepatectomy safer and may stimulate the development of transplant oncology.

Abstract
Pleural effusion and hypoalbuminaemia frequently occur after hepatectomy. Despite the emphasis on the safety of donors, little is known about the impact of postoperative albumin level on pleural effusion in liver donors. We retrospectively assessed 2316 consecutive liver donors from 2004 to 2014. The analysis of donors from 2004 to 2012 showed that postoperative pleural effusion occurred in 47.4% (970/2046), and serum albumin levels decreased until postoperative day 2 (POD2) and increased thereafter. In multivariable analysis, the lowest albumin level within POD2 (POD2ALB) was inversely associated with pleural effusion (OR 0.28, 95% CI 0.20-0.38; P < 0.001). POD2ALB ≤3.0 g/dL, the cutoff value at the 75th percentile, was associated with increased incidence of pleural effusion after propensity score (PS) matching (431 pairs; OR 1.69, 95% CI 1.30-2.21; P < 0.001). When we further analysed data from 2010 to 2014, intraoperative albumin infusion was associated with higher POD2ALB (P < 0.001) and lower incidence of pleural effusion (P = 0.024), compared with synthetic colloid infusion after PS matching (193 pairs). In conclusion, our data showed that POD2ALB is inversely associated with pleural effusion, and that intraoperative albumin infusion is associated with a lower incidence of pleural effusion when compared to synthetic colloid infusion in liver donors.

Abstract
BACKGROUND/AIMS Biliary complications are the most common donor complication following living donor liver transplantation (LDLT). The aim of this study is to investigate the long-term outcomes of biliary complications in right lobe adult-to-adult LDLT donors, and to evaluate the efficacy of endoscopic treatment of these donors. METHODS The medical charts of right lobe donors who developed biliary complications between June 2000 and January 2008 were retrospectively reviewed. RESULTS Of 337 right lobe donors, 49 developed biliary complications, including 36 diagnosed with biliary leakage and 13 with biliary stricture. Multivariate analysis showed that biliary leakage was associated with the number of right lobe bile duct orifices. Sixteen donors, five with leakage and 11 with strictures, underwent endoscopic retrograde cholangiography (ERC). ERC was clinically successful in treating eight of the 11 strictures, one by balloon dilatation and seven by endobiliary stenting. Of the remained three, two were treated by rescue percutaneous biliary drainage and one by conservative care. Of the five patients with leakage, four were successfully treated using endobiliary stents and one with conservative care. In overall, total 35 improved with conservative treatment. All inserted stents were successfully retrieved after a median 264 days (range, 142 to 502) and there were no recurrences of stricture or leakages during a median follow-up of 10.6 years (range, 8 to 15.2). CONCLUSIONS All donors with biliary complications were successfully treated non-surgically, with most improving after endoscopic placement of endobiliary stents and none showing recurrence on long term follow-up.

Abstract
OBJECTIVE To determine the relationship between a transplant center's experience and life-threatening or nearly life-threatening complications during living donor hepatectomy (LDH). METHODS The medical records of 1140 patients who underwent LDH were analyzed. To determine the relationship between life-threatening complications and a transplant center's experience, the following comparisons between LDH cases were performed: first 100 vs subsequent 100; first 100 vs subsequent 1040; first 200 vs subsequent 940; right hepatectomy vs left hepatectomy; and first 5 years of experience vs subsequent 5 years. RESULTS A total of 36 life-threatening or nearly life-threatening complications developed in 34 of 1140 (2.98%) healthy individuals undergoing LDH. Of these, 5 occurred intraoperatively, 26 within 1 month, and 5 beyond 1 month. The most common complications were biliary problems and postoperative bleeding. None of the donors died at follow-up. One donor underwent deceased donor liver transplantation (DDLT) for severe hepatic failure. Only 2 comparisons were significantly different with regard to life-threatening complications: the first 100 vs the subsequent 1040 (P = .03) and the first 200 vs the subsequent 940 (P = .01). CONCLUSION This study indicates that the incidence of life-threatening or nearly life-threatening complications are reduced by increased center experience (>200 LDHs).

Abstract
OBJECTIVE Morbidity rates after living donor hepatectomy vary greatly among centers. Donor morbidity in a tertiary center over the past two decades was revisited. METHODS Clinical data and grading of complications were reviewed by a nontransplant surgeon based on Clavien 5 tier grading. Risk factors were analyzed. RESULTS In total, 473 consecutive living liver donors from 1997 to 2016 were included for analysis; 305 were right liver donors and 168 left liver donors, and the corresponding morbidity rates were 27.2% and 9.5%. The majority (81/99, 81.2%) of complications were grade I and II. Donors with morbidity compared with those without were significantly younger, nonoverweight body figure (BMI < 25), more as the right liver donors, and longer length of hospital stay. Right liver donation had significantly higher morbidity rates than did left liver donation in earlier periods (before 2011), but not thereafter. Multivariate modeling revealed that right lobe donation and overweight (BMI ≥ 25 kg/m2) were significant factors associated with donor morbidity, with adjusted hazard ratios HR (95% confidence interval) of 3.401 (1.909-6.060) and 0.550 (0.304-0.996), respectively. Further, overweight was a paradoxical risk factor in right donor hepatectomy with HR 0.422 (0.209-0.851), but the effect was nonsignificant in left liver donors. Most complications in overweight donors were grade I and not specific to liver surgery. CONCLUSIONS The overall complication rate was 20.9%. Overweight might be protective against morbidity in right hepatectomy and warrants further deliberation.

Abstract
Major concerns about donor safety cause controversy and limit the use of living donor liver transplantation to overcome organ shortages. The Korean Organ Transplantation Registry established a nationwide organ transplantation registration system in 2014. We reviewed the prospectively collected data of all 832 living liver donors who underwent procedures between April 2014 and December 2015. We allocated the donors to a left lobe group (n = 59) and a right lobe group (n = 773) and analyzed the relations between graft types and remaining liver volumes and complications (graded using the Clavien 5-tier grading system). The median follow-up was 19 months (range, 10-31 months). During the study period, 553 men and 279 women donated livers, and there were no deaths after living liver donation. The overall, biliary, and major complication (grade ≥ III) rates were 9.3%, 1.7%, and 1.9%, respectively. The graft types and remaining liver volume were associated with significantly different overall, biliary, and major complication rates. Of the 16 patients with major complications, 9 (56.3%) involved biliary complications (2 biliary strictures [12.5%] and 7 bile leakages [43.8%]). Among the 832 donors, the mean aspartate transaminase, alanine aminotransferase, and total bilirubin levels were 23.9 ± 8.1 IU/L, 20.9 ± 11.3 IU/L, and 0.8 ± 0.4 mg/dL, respectively, 6 months after liver donation. In conclusion, biliary complications were the most common types of major morbidity in living liver donors. Donor hepatectomy can be performed successfully with minimal and easily controlled complications. Our study shows that prospective, nationwide cohort data provide an important means of investigating the safety in living liver donation. Liver Transplantation 23 999-1006 2017 AASLD.

Abstract
AIM We aimed to evaluate whether functional assessment of the future remnant liver is a predictor of postoperative morbidity after hepatic resection in patients with hepatocellular carcinoma (HCC). METHODS One hundred forty-six patients who underwent hepatic resection for HCC were enrolled in this study. Gadolinium-ethoxybenzyl-diethylenetriamine pentaacetic acid enhanced MRI (EOB-MRI) analysis for functional liver assessment was carried out before hepatic resection. The signal intensity in the remnant liver was measured and divided by the signal intensity of the major psoas muscle (the liver to major psoas muscle ratio, LMR) for standardization. The remnant liver function was calculated using the formula (LMR on the hepatobiliary phase/LMR on the precontrast image). Computed tomography liver volumetry was also carried out. The remnant functional liver was calculated as the remnant liver volume or volumetric rate × remnant liver function by EOB-MRI. RESULTS Morbidities developed in 19 (13.0%) patients. Morbidities associated with the liver occurred in 7 patients (4.7%). There was no mortality during surgery. Median remnant liver function scores using EOB-MRI and remnant functional liver using volumetric rate or volumetry were 1.82 (range, 1.25-2.96), 155.9 (range, 64.7-285.3), and 1027 (range, 369-2148), respectively. Logistic regression analysis identified the remnant functional liver volume as the only independent predictor for liver-related morbidity. CONCLUSION Remnant functional liver volume using computed tomography liver volumetry and EOB-MRI was a significantly useful predictor for liver-related morbidity after hepatic resection in patients with HCC.

Abstract
Major concerns about donor morbidity and mortality still limit the use of living donor liver transplantation (LDLT) to overcome the organ shortage. The present study assessed donor safety in LDLT in Italy reporting donor postoperative outcomes in 246 living donation procedures performed by 7 transplant centers. Outcomes were evaluated over 2 time periods using the validated Clavien 5-tier grading system, and several clinical variables were analyzed to determine the risk factors for donor morbidity. Different grafts were obtained from the 246 donor procedures (220 right lobe, 10 left lobe, and 16 left lateral segments). The median follow-up after donation was 112 months. There was no donor mortality. One or more complications occurred in 82 (33.3%) donors, and 3 of them had intraoperative complications (1.2%). Regardless of graft type, the rate of major complications (grade ≥ 3) was 12.6% (31/246). The overall donor morbidity and the rate of major complications did not differ significantly over time: 26 (10.6%) donors required hospital readmission throughout the follow-up period, whereas 5 (2.0%) donors required reoperation. Prolonged operative time (>400 minutes), intraoperative hypotension (systolic < 100 mm Hg), vascular abnormalities, and intraoperative blood loss (>300 mL) were multivariate risk factors for postoperative donor complications. In conclusion, from the standpoint of living donor surgery, a meticulous and well-standardized technique that reduces operative time and prevents blood loss and intraoperative hypotension may reduce the incidence of donor complications. Transparency in reporting results after LDLT is mandatory, and we should continue to strive for zero donor mortality. Liver Transplantation 23 184-193 2017 AASLD.

Abstract
The objective of this nationwide cohort study was to investigate the risk of peptic ulcer disease (PUD) in living liver donors (LDs). A total of 1333 LDs and 5332 matched nondonors were identified during 2003-2011. Hospitalized patients identified as LDs were assigned to the LD cohort, and the non-LD comparison cohort comprised age- and sex-matched nondonors. Cumulative incidences and hazard ratios (HRs) were calculated. The overall incidence of PUD was 1.74-fold higher in the LD cohort than in the non-LD cohort (2.14 vs. 1.48 per 1000 person-years). After adjustment for age, sex, monthly income and comorbidities, we determined that the LD cohort exhibited a higher risk of PUD than did the non-LD cohort (adjusted HR 1.74, 95% confidence interval [CI] 1.45-2.09). The incidence of PUD increased with age; the risk of PUD was 2.53-fold higher in patients aged ≥35 years (95% CI 2.14-2.99) than in those aged ≤34 years. LDs with comorbidities of osteopathies, chondropathies and acquired musculoskeletal deformities exhibited a higher risk of PUD (adjusted HR 3.93, 95% CI 2.64-5.86) compared with those without these comorbidities. LDs are associated with an increased risk of PUD after hepatectomy.

Abstract
To ensure donor safety in living donor liver transplantation (LDLT), the left and caudate lobe (LL) is the preferred graft choice. However, patient prognosis may still be poor even if graft volume (GV) selection criteria are met. Our aim was to evaluate the effects of right lobe (RL) donation when the LL graft selection criteria are met. Consecutive donors (n = 135) with preoperative LL graft volumetric GV/standard liver volume (SLV) of ≥35% and RL remnant of ≥35% were retrospectively studied. Patients were divided into 2 groups: LL graft and RL graft. Recipient's body surface area (BSA), Model for End-Stage Liver Disease (MELD) score, and the donor's age were higher in the RL group. The donor's BSA and preoperative volumetric GV/SLV of the LL graft were smaller in the RL group. The predicted score (calculated using data for graft size, donor age, MELD score, and the presence of portosystemic shunt, which correlated well with graft function and with 6-month graft survival) of the RL group, was significantly lower if the LL graft were used, but using the actual RL graft improved the score equal to that of the LL group. Six-month and 12-month graft survival rates did not differ between the 2 groups. In patients with a poor prognosis, a larger RL graft improved the predicted score and survival was equal to that of patients who received LL grafts. In conclusion, graft selection by GV, donor age, and recipient MELD score improves outcomes in LDLT. Liver Transplantation 22 914-922 2016 AASLD.

Abstract
In living donor liver transplantation (LDLT), a left hepatic graft occasionally includes a replaced or accessory left hepatic artery (LHA). The procuring of such grafts requires extensive dissection along the lesser curvature of the stomach to elongate the replaced or accessory LHA on the donor side. On the recipient side, complicated arterial reconstruction is often necessary to use such grafts. We retrospectively reviewed the medical records of 206 adult recipients who underwent LDLT and their respective donors. The recipients and donors were divided into two groups according to the presence of the replaced or accessory LHA. Twenty-five grafts included a replaced or accessory LHA. Only one hepatic artery-related complication was observed in the current series, in which a pseudoaneurysm arose at the site of anastomosis between the donor accessory LHA and the recipient LHA. There was no increase in the incidence of postoperative complications in the donors with a replaced or accessory LHA in comparison with the donors without these arteries. The use of left hepatic grafts that included a replaced LHA or accessory LHA did not have any negative impact on the outcomes on either the donor or the recipient side.

Abstract
Living donor liver transplant (LDLT) accounts for a small volume of the transplants in the USA. Due to the current liver allocation system based on the model for end-stage liver disease (MELD), LDLT has a unique role in providing life-saving transplantation for patients with low MELD scores and significant complications from portal hypertension, as well as select patients with hepatocellular carcinoma (HCC). Donor safety is paramount and has been a topic of much discussion in the transplant community as well as the general media. The donor risk appears to be low overall, with a favorable long-term quality of life. The latest trend has been a gradual shift from right-lobe grafts to left-lobe grafts to reduce donor risk, provided that the left lobe can provide adequate liver volume for the recipient.

Abstract
We conducted a retrospective investigation in order to clarify whether selecting the type of liver graft had an impact on outcomes of adult-to-adult living donor liver transplantation (AALDLT). Data from the medical records of the donors and the recipients of 321 consecutive cases of AALDLT performed between April 2004 and March 2014 were retrospectively analyzed. Our general criteria for selecting the type of liver graft was that a left graft was preferentially selected when the estimated volume of the left graft was ≥35% of the standard liver volume of the recipient, and that a right graft was selected only when the estimated remnant liver volume of the donor was ≥35% of the total liver volume. In this series, 177 left grafts, 136 right grafts, and 8 posterior grafts were used. The left grafts tended to have 2 or more arteries, whereas the right grafts tended to have 2 or more bile duct orifices. The graft survival curves and the incidences of severe complications were comparable between the AALDLT using right grafts and the AALDLT using left grafts. The preoperative estimation of graft size hardly enabled us to predict severe posttransplant complication. Moreover, small-for-size graft syndrome occurred regardless of the estimated graft volumes. Instead, donor age was a significant risk factor for small-for-size graft syndrome. In conclusion, left grafts should be more aggressively used for the sake of donors' safety. The use of hepatic grafts from older donors should be avoided if possible in order to circumvent troublesome posttransplant complications.

Abstract
BACKGROUND The safety of healthy living donors who are undergoing hepatic resection is a primary concern. We aimed to identify intraoperative anaesthetic and surgical factors associated with delayed recovery of liver function after hepatectomy in living donors. METHODS We retrospectively analysed 1969 living donors who underwent hepatectomy for living donor liver transplantation. Delayed recovery of hepatic function was defined by increases in international normalised ratio of prothrombin time and concomitant hyperbilirubinaemia on or after post-operative day 5. Univariate and multivariate logistic regression analyses were performed to determine the factors associated with delayed recovery of hepatic function after living donor hepatectomy. RESULTS Delayed recovery of liver function after donor hepatectomy was observed in 213 (10.8%) donors. Univariate logistic regression analysis showed that sevoflurane anaesthesia, synthetic colloid, donor age, body mass index, fatty change and remnant liver volume were significant factors for prediction of delayed recovery of hepatic function. Multivariate logistic regression analysis showed that independent factors significantly associated with delayed recovery of liver function after donor hepatectomy were sevoflurane anaesthesia (odds ratio = 3.514, P < 0.001), synthetic colloid (odds ratio = 1.045, P = 0.033), donor age (odds ratio = 0.970, P = 0.003), female gender (odds ratio = 1.512, P = 0.014) and remnant liver volume (odds ratio = 0.963, P < 0.001). CONCLUSIONS Anaesthesia with sevoflurane was an independent factor in predicting delayed recovery of hepatic function after donor hepatectomy. Although synthetic colloid may be associated with delayed recovery of hepatic function after donor hepatectomy, further study is required. These results can provide useful information on perioperative management of living liver donors.

Abstract
Living donor liver transplantation (LDLT) is a curative treatment for end stage liver disease. It is advantageous due to the shortage of deceased donors. However, in LDLT, whether the middle hepatic vein (MHV) should be preserved in donors remains controversial. We conducted searches in Pubmed, Embase, Cochrane Library, Web of Science, Ovid, and Google Scholar using the key words "living donor liver transplantation" and "middle hepatic vein". Due to ethical issues, there were no randomized control trails focusing on MHV in LDLT. The majority of reports were retrospective studies. We examined the reference lists to identify related investigations. Google Scholar was then used to obtain full texts. Nine observational studies were analyzed. There were no significant differences in liver function (WMD, -5.51; P=0.12) and complications (RR, 0.98; P=0.89) in donors with or without MHV. However, the liver function in recipients was greatly improved after LDLT with MHV (WMD, -78.32; P=0.01). No definite conclusion was obtained in terms of the liver regeneration indices between LDLT with or without MHV. It was conclude that grafts with MHV in LDLT favor recipient outcomes and do not harm the living donor if a careful preoperative evaluation is performed.

Abstract
The aims of this study were to evaluate the efficacy of repeat hepatectomy (Hx) and salvage living donor liver transplantation (LDLT) for recurrent hepatocellular carcinoma (HCC). A retrospective cohort study was performed to analyze the surgical results of repeat Hx and salvage LDLT for patients with recurrent HCC within the Milan criteria from 1989 to 2012. A total of 159 patients were divided into 2 groups: a repeat Hx group (n = 146) and a salvage LDLT group (n = 13). Operative results and patient prognoses were compared between the 2 groups. The operative invasiveness, including the operation time (229.1 ± 97.7 versus 862.9 ± 194.4 minutes; P < 0.0001) and blood loss (596.3 ± 764.9 versus 24,690 ± 59,014.4 g; P < 0.0001), were significantly higher in the salvage LDLT group. The early surgical results, such as morbidity (31% versus 62%; P = 0.0111) and the duration of hospital stay (20 ± 22 versus 35 ± 21 days; P = 0.0180), were significantly worse in the salvage LDLT group. There was no significant difference in the overall survival (OS) rate, but the disease-free survival rate of the salvage LDLT group was significantly better (P = 0.0002). The OS rate of patients with grade B liver damage in the repeat Hx group was significantly worse (P < 0.0001), and the 5-year OS rate was quite low, that is, 20% (liver damage A, 77% for the repeat Hx group and 75% for the salvage LDLT group). The prognosis of patients with grade B liver damage after repeat Hx for recurrent HCC is poor, and salvage LDLT would be a potent option for such patients.

Abstract
AIM Donor safety is the major concern in living-donor liver transplantation. Studies in literature related to donor hepatectomy (DH) have generally considered intra-abdominal complications. The aim of this study is to specifically evaluate pulmonary complications (PCs) after DH. MATERIALS AND METHODS We evaluated retrospectively 1150 living donors who underwent to DH between January 2007 and July 2014. Patients with PCs, such as pneumonia, pleural effusion, pneumothorax, and respiratory insufficiency, were considered. A complication was considered only when it was clinically apparent and/or requiring interventions. Any special diagnostic tool was used to expose the clinically silent pathologies. RESULTS A total of 986 right hepatectomies (RH) and 164 left hepatectomies (LH) (left lobectomy or left lateral segmentectomy) were performed in the study interval. There were 18 (1.6%) donors with PCs (15 males and 3 females). Mean age was 33.8 ± 9.3 years (18-51). Mean hospital stay was 23.8 ± 13.5 days (5-62). Presented PCs were pleural effusion (n = 5, 0.4%), pneumonia (n = 4, 0.3%), combinations (n = 2, 0.2%), pneumothorax (n = 2, 0.2%), and acute respiratory insufficiency (n = 5, 0.4%). Sixteen cases (1.7%) were seen after RH, whereas 2 cases (1.2%) were seen after LH (P = 1.000). CONCLUSION The most common PCs after living donor hepatectomy were pleural effusion and acute respiratory insufficiency. There was no significant difference between RH and LH. It is possible to overcome those PCs with careful monitoring and timely and appropriate treatment.

Abstract
Donor safety remains an important concern in living donor liver transplantation (LDLT). In the present study, we assessed recent advancements in the donor operation for LDLT through our experience with this procedure. A total of 886 donor hepatectomies performed between January 1999 and December 2012 were analyzed. Three chronological periods were investigated: the initial period (1999-2004, n = 239), the period in which the right liver with middle hepatic vein reconstruction was primarily used (2005-2010, n = 422), and the period in which the right liver with a standardized protocol, including a preoperative donor diet program, an evaluation of steatosis with magnetic resonance spectroscopy, no systemic heparin administration or central venous pressure monitoring, exact midplane dissection, and incremental application of minimal incisions, was exclusively used (2011-2012, n = 225). The proportion of patients > 50 years old increased (2.5% versus 4.7% versus 8.9%), whereas the proportion of patients with a remnant liver volume ≤ 30% (6.5% versus 13.9% versus 6.3%) and with macrosteatosis ≥ 10% (7.9% versus 11.1% versus 4.4%) decreased throughout the periods. The operative time (292.7 versus 290.0 versus 272.8 minutes), hospital stay (12.4 versus 11.2 versus 8.5 days), and overall morbidity rate (26.4% versus 13.3% versus 5.8%), including major complications (>grade 3; 1.7% versus 1.9% versus 0.9%) and biliary complications (7.9% versus 5.0% versus 0.9%), were markedly reduced in the most recent period. No intraoperative transfusion was required. No cases of irreversible disability or mortality were noted. In conclusion, the quality of the donor operation has recently been standardized through a large volume of experience, and the operation has been proven to have minimal risk. However, a constant evaluation of our experience is critical for remaining prepared for any unavoidable crisis.

Abstract
Delayed gastric emptying is a significant postoperative complication of living donor hepatectomy for liver transplantation and may require endoscopic or surgical intervention in severe cases. Although the mechanism of posthepatectomy delayed gastric emptying remains unknown, vagal nerve injury during intraoperative dissection and adhesion formation postoperatively between the stomach and cut liver surface are possible explanations. Here, we present the first reported case of delayed gastric emptying following fully laparoscopic hepatectomy for living donor liver transplantation. Additionally, we also present a case in which symptoms developed after open right hepatectomy, but for which dissection for left hepatectomy was first performed. Through our experience and these two specific cases, we favor a neurovascular etiology for delayed gastric emptying after hepatectomy.

Abstract
Right posterior sector (RPS) grafts have been used to overcome graft size discrepancies, the major concern of living donor liver transplantation. Previous studies have reported the volumetry-based selection of RPS grafts without anatomical exclusion. We reviewed our data and established selection criteria for RPS grafts. The procurement of RPS grafts [conventional (n = 3) and extended (n = 5)] was performed for 8 of 429 recipients at our center. Extended RPS grafts contained the drainage area of the right hepatic vein. The mean graft weight (GW) according to 3-dimensional computed tomography volumetry was 488 g, and the GW/standard liver weight (SLW) ratio was 42.6%. The mean actual GW was 437 g, and the GW/SLW ratio was 38.4%. One donor exhibited standard bifurcation of the right portal vein (PV) and the left PV, and 2 donors exhibited trifurcation of the left PV, the right anterior portal vein (APV), and the posterior PV. The remaining 5 donors exhibited APV branching from the left PV, which is the most suitable anatomy for RPS grafts. Two recipients died of sepsis or small-for-size graft syndrome. One underwent retransplantation because of an intractable bile leak and fibrosing cholestatic hepatitis. Intractable bile duct (BD) stenosis developed in 4 of the 6 survivors. In conclusion, with the significant complications and potential concerns associated with RPS grafts, these grafts should be used very rarely and with extreme caution. Donors with the standard bifurcation of the PV and the posterior BD running through the dorsal side of the posterior PV are not suitable candidates for RPS grafts. Extended RPS graft procurement is recommended for easier parenchymal transection.
